There were a lot of mistakes made on both sides of the field but it just seemed that John Glenn was able to capitalize on those mistakes a little faster.
The Little Muskies made the first strike and a big one at that. Receiver Joseph Clifford returned a punt from their own 3-yard line breaking tackles to get an opening and run all the way for a 97-yard touchdown.
The Scotties were able to answer back with an interception that ended with a 41-yard touchdown run by #3 Cade Sterling followed by the extra point kick by #46 Kaden Bay to tie the game 7 – 7.
Both teams were having trouble inching down the field, but the Little Muskies were able to pick up another touchdown midway through the third quarter of play bringing the score to 14 – 7 John Glenn.
The Scotties were unable to recover although they came close with a final drive that pushed them within reach, but they came up just short on the final play of the game.
